ubuntu中用户不是系统用户怎么办
首先,我们需要了解Ubuntu操作系统中的用户类型。在Ubuntu中,用户分为系统用户和普通用户两种类型。系统用户具有更高的权限,并且可以对操作系统进行更深入的访问和修改,而普通用户则受到更多的限制。如果您的用户不是系统用户,您可能会遇到一些权限和功能方面的限制。不用担心,下面是一些解决此问题的方法和步骤。
第一步是确认当前用户的类型。您可以通过在终端中输入以下命令来查看当前用户的信息:
```bash
id
```
系统会返回一串数字,其中包含用户的信息。如果您是系统用户,那么显示的结果中会有"uid0"或"root"字样。如果您的用户类型不是系统用户,那么我们可以按照以下步骤来解决这个问题。
第二步是创建一个新的系统用户。在终端中输入以下命令来创建一个系统用户:
```bash
sudo adduser newuser --system
```
其中,"newuser"是您要创建的新用户的用户名。这个命令将创建一个新的系统用户,并赋予其系统权限。在执行完这个命令后,系统会提示您设置新用户的密码和其他相关信息。请根据提示进行操作。
第三步是将现有用户转为系统用户。如果您已经有一个普通用户,并且想将其转为系统用户,可以按照以下步骤操作:
首先,确认您当前的用户是否有sudo权限。在终端中输入以下命令:
```bash
sudo -l
```
系统会返回您当前用户的sudo权限信息。如果显示"Matching Defaults entries for yourusername on thishost:",那么您的用户具有sudo权限。
然后,将当前用户添加到sudo组中。在终端中输入以下命令:
```bash
sudo usermod -aG sudo yourusername
```
其中,"yourusername"是您当前用户的用户名。这个命令将把当前用户添加到sudo组中,从而赋予其系统权限。
最后,重新登录并验证您的用户的类型。在终端中输入以下命令:
```bash
id
```
系统会返回您的用户信息。确认其中是否包含"uid0"或"root"字样,以验证用户类型是否已成功更改。如果成功更改,恭喜您,您现在是一个系统用户了。
总结:Ubuntu中用户不是系统用户的问题可以通过创建一个新的系统用户或将现有用户转为系统用户来解决。本文详细介绍了解决方法和步骤,希望能对Ubuntu用户有所帮助。无论您是新手还是有经验的用户,都可以根据上述指导解决此问题。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。